25 Gratitude Quotes On Success

The definition of gratitude is a feeling of being thankful and appreciative. An example of gratitude is how someone would feel if their friend did something exceptionally nice for them. Gratitude is the key attitude to success. Be grateful for all that you have you will get more in an abundance. Too many people tend to focus their mind on what they don’t have rather than being grateful for what they do have. May these Gratitude Quotes On Success inspire you to take action so that you may live your dreams.

1. “As we express our gratitude, we must never forget that the highest appreciation is not to utter words, but to live by them.” John F. Kennedy

2. “Gratitude makes sense of our past, brings peace for today, and creates a vision for tomorrow.” Melody Beattie

3. “Give yourself a gift of five minutes of contemplation in awe of everything you see around you. Go outside and turn your attention to the many miracles around you. This five-minute-a-day regimen of appreciation and gratitude will help you to focus your life in awe.” Wayne Dyer

4. “Showing gratitude is one of the simplest yet most powerful things humans can do for each other.” Randy Pausch

5. “Sometimes we should express our gratitude for the small and simple things like the scent of the rain, the taste of your favorite food, or the sound of a loved one’s voice.” Joseph B. Wirthlin

6. “Gratitude, like faith, is a muscle. The more you use it, the stronger it grows.” Alan Cohen

7. “Develop an attitude of gratitude, and give thanks for everything that happens to you, knowing that every step forward is a step toward achieving something bigger and better than your current situation.” Brian Tracy

8. “We learned about gratitude and humility – that so many people had a hand in our success, from the teachers who inspired us to the janitors who kept our school clean, and we were taught to value everyone’s contribution and treat everyone with respect.” Michelle Obama

9. “Gratitude can transform common days into thanksgivings, turn routine jobs into joy, and change ordinary opportunities into blessings.” William Arthur Ward

10. “Gratitude unlocks the fullness of life. It turns what we have into enough, and more. It turns denial into acceptance, chaos to order, confusion to clarity. It can turn a meal into a feast, a house into a home, a stranger into a friend.” Melody Beattie

11. “Feeling gratitude and not expressing it is like wrapping a present and not giving it.” William Arthur Ward

12. “When we focus on our gratitude, the tide of disappointment goes out and the tide of love rushes in.” Kristin Armstrong

13. “Thankfulness is the beginning of gratitude. Gratitude is the completion of thankfulness. Thankfulness may consist merely of words. Gratitude is shown in acts.” Henri Frederic Amiel

14. “Gratitude opens the door to the power, the wisdom, the creativity of the universe. You open the door through gratitude.” Deepak Chopra

15. “Gratitude is not only the greatest of virtues, but the parent of all the others.” Marcus Tullius Cicero

16. “If you concentrate on finding whatever is good in every situation, you will discover that your life will suddenly be filled with gratitude, a feeling that nurtures the soul.” Harold S. Kushner

17. “Gratitude is when memory is stored in the heart and not in the mind.” Lionel Hampton

18. “Gratitude bestows reverence, allowing us to encounter everyday epiphanies, those transcendent moments of awe that change forever how we experience life and the world.” John Milton

19. “Gratitude helps you to grow and expand; gratitude brings joy and laughter into your life and into the lives of all those around you.” Eileen Caddy

20. “No one who achieves success does so without acknowledging the help of others. The wise and confident acknowledge this help with gratitude.” Alfred North Whitehead

21. “To educate yourself for the feeling of gratitude means to take nothing for granted.” Albert Schweitzer

22. “Gratitude is the healthiest of all human emotions. The more you express gratitude for what you have, the more likely you will have even more to express gratitude for.” Zig Ziglar
